What's Included

What X / Twitter Advertising Actually Covers

X / Twitter advertising at Avana Hub is not ad setup and walk away. It is a structured, strategy-led service — from objective definition and precision targeting through to active optimisation and performance reporting.

Campaign Strategy & Objective Setup

Every X campaign begins with a clear business objective — awareness, traffic, engagement, or conversions. We translate your commercial goal into a campaign architecture with the right objective type, bidding model, and success metrics. Strategy-first means your ad spend works from the first impression, not after the budget runs out.

Campaign objective selection · Funnel stage mapping · Bidding model selection · KPI definition · Campaign architecture design

Audience Targeting & Segmentation

X's targeting capabilities are more sophisticated than most advertisers realise — keyword targeting, follower look-alikes, interest layers, conversation targeting, and tailored audiences. We build targeting structures that reach the precise audience your message is designed for: not just users on X, but the right users, at the right moment.

Keyword and conversation targeting · Follower look-alike audiences · Interest and behaviour layers · Tailored audience setup · Geographic and demographic segmentation

Ad Creative & Copy Alignment

X is a text-first environment where copy quality determines whether your promoted content earns engagement or gets scrolled past. We align ad creative and copy with your campaign objective, audience mindset, and brand tone — ensuring each ad format (promoted tweet, image ad, video ad, carousel) is structured for maximum relevance and click-through.

Copy direction and refinement · Format selection per objective · Hook and CTA alignment · Creative brief production · A/B message testing

Budget Management & Bid Strategy

Spend without a bid strategy is a fast way to exhaust budget on the wrong clicks. We manage budget allocation across campaigns and ad sets, select the right bid types (automatic, target cost, max bid), and adjust spend distribution based on real performance data — so your budget concentrates where it earns the most.

Daily and lifetime budget setting · Bid type selection and management · Budget allocation across campaigns · Spend pacing and monitoring · Budget reallocation based on performance

Campaign Launch & Technical Setup

Campaign setup errors — wrong pixel events, unverified conversion tracking, misconfigured ad sets — silently destroy performance. We handle the technical campaign build with precision: conversion tracking, pixel verification, UTM parameter setup, audience upload, and ad group structuring. Launch right the first time.

Pixel installation and verification · Conversion event configuration · UTM parameter structure · Ad group and campaign structuring · Pre-launch technical QA checklist

KPI Tracking & Performance Monitoring

We track the metrics that matter to your campaign objective — not the ones that look impressive in a screenshot. CTR, CPC, CPE, conversion rate, ROAS (where applicable), and audience reach quality are monitored continuously. Performance signals inform active campaign adjustments rather than waiting for monthly reports.

KPI framework setup per campaign · Real-time performance monitoring · CTR, CPC, and CPE tracking · Conversion attribution review · Weekly performance check-ins

Reporting & Ongoing Optimisation

Campaigns that don't improve are campaigns that waste budget. Every reporting cycle includes not just what happened, but what it means and what changes next — creative rotation, targeting adjustment, bid refinement, or budget reallocation. Our optimisation process is data-led and commercially aligned, not cosmetic.

Structured performance report delivery · Optimisation recommendations per cycle · Creative refresh direction · Audience refinement signals · Next-campaign improvement planning

Why Campaigns Fail

Eight Reasons X / Twitter Ad Campaigns Underperform

Most X advertising failures aren't platform problems. They're structural campaign problems — the same eight patterns appear in the majority of underperforming X ad accounts. These are the issues a structured approach is designed to prevent.

Targeting is too broad or too generic

Default X campaign targeting reaches a mass audience by design. Without intentional layer stacking — keyword targeting, interest clusters, follower look-alikes, conversation context — campaigns reach users who have no relevance to the brand, product, or message. Broad targeting produces large impression numbers and minimal engagement, because reach and relevance are not the same thing.

No clear campaign objective is defined

Many X advertising campaigns begin with a vague goal: 'more visibility' or 'more engagement'. Without a specific objective — traffic, follower acquisition, awareness in a defined audience, or conversion — there is no bidding model to select, no KPI to measure, and no optimisation signal to act on. Campaigns without objectives spend their way to average results.

Poor message-to-moment alignment

X is a real-time, context-sensitive platform. A promoted post that ignores current conversations, trending topics, or audience sentiment feels out of place — and gets treated accordingly. Campaigns that don't connect the message to what the audience is currently thinking about produce lower engagement rates, higher CPCs, and weaker quality scores regardless of how well the underlying product or service is positioned.

Weak ad copy that doesn't earn the click

On X, you are competing with organic content, news, and professional commentary in a single feed. Copy that reads like an ad — generic, feature-led, over-formal — is mentally filtered out before the CTA is even registered. Effective X ad copy is natively formatted: direct, specific, and conversational enough to earn attention from a scroll-first audience. Most underperforming campaigns are losing the copy battle.

Vanity metrics used as KPIs

Impression count and total reach are the default metrics most X campaigns optimise for — and the least useful for assessing business value. A campaign that produces 500,000 impressions with a 0.2% CTR, zero conversion tracking, and no attribution to business outcomes has delivered reach and nothing else. Campaigns structured around vanity metrics produce vanity outcomes.

No conversion tracking or attribution

Running X campaigns without a properly configured pixel and conversion events means flying without instruments. You can see impressions, clicks, and follows — but you cannot connect any of them to business outcomes. Without conversion attribution, every X advertising decision is based on incomplete data. Brands that don't track conversions don't know what's working, can't optimise for what matters, and can't justify continued investment.

Creative fatigue goes unmanaged

Audiences see the same ad 3, 5, 10 times and stop engaging. CTR drops, CPC rises, and the campaign continues running on the same creative as if nothing changed. Creative fatigue is a predictable decay curve — not a platform problem — and it requires proactive rotation based on frequency and performance data, not intuition or calendar schedules.

Budget is spent on the wrong campaigns

Without cross-campaign performance comparison, budget defaults to equal distribution or to whichever campaign was set up first. High-performing campaigns are under-resourced; underperforming campaigns continue consuming budget because no one reviewed the allocation. Budget concentration around the campaigns that produce the best return-on-spend is the most reliable lever for improving overall X advertising performance.

Our Framework

The Avana Hub X Advertising Framework

Five principles that shape how we plan, launch, and optimise every X / Twitter advertising campaign — from objective definition through to performance refinement.

01

Objective Clarity

Define the campaign purpose before defining the campaign

Every campaign decision — bid type, targeting layer, ad format, creative approach — follows from a clear objective. We begin every X advertising engagement by defining the specific commercial outcome the campaign is designed to produce: qualified reach, traffic, follower acquisition, engagement, or conversion. Objective clarity is not the start of a creative brief. It is the constraint that makes every subsequent decision purposeful rather than experimental.

Campaign objective mapped to commercial outcome

Funnel stage identified (awareness, consideration, conversion)

Bid model selected to match objective

KPI framework defined before campaign launches

02

Targeting Precision

Reach the right audience, not just a large one

X offers targeting capabilities that most advertisers use at the surface level: basic interests and demographics. We build targeting structures in layers — keyword and conversation intent, follower look-alikes from relevant accounts, interest cluster stacking, and tailored audience uploads. Precision targeting ensures your ad spend reaches people whose professional context, behaviour, and interests match your campaign objective — not just people on X.

Layered targeting structure per campaign

Keyword and conversation targeting sets built

Follower look-alike audiences configured

Tailored audience upload and custom audience segmentation

03

Message-to-Moment Fit

Ad copy and creative matched to audience context and platform behaviour

X is a real-time, text-first environment. Ad copy that performs on Instagram or LinkedIn rarely performs natively on X — the format, register, and hook logic are different. We align your ad creative and copy to the X context: direct, conversational, specific, and structured for a scroll-first audience. Where the campaign is timed to a live moment — a trend, event, or breaking topic — we align the message to that context rather than running generic campaign creative.

Copy direction matched to campaign objective and audience context

Format selection per ad type (promoted tweet, image, video, carousel)

Hook and CTA aligned to scroll-first audience behaviour

Creative brief for real-time and moment-aligned campaigns

04

KPI Tracking

Measure what connects to business outcomes, not what looks good

We configure KPI tracking before every campaign launches — not as an afterthought. Pixel installation, conversion event setup, UTM parameter structure, and attribution window configuration are technical prerequisites, not optional extras. The KPIs we track are selected based on campaign objective: CTR for traffic campaigns, CPF for follower acquisition, CPE for engagement, ROAS or CPA for conversion-oriented campaigns. Vanity metrics are secondary to commercial evidence.

X pixel installation and verification

Conversion event configuration per campaign objective

UTM parameter structure for attribution clarity

KPI dashboard setup for real-time performance visibility

05

Optimisation Loop

Continuous refinement based on what the data shows

Campaigns that don't improve will decay. Creative fatigue, audience saturation, bid drift, and seasonal shifts all erode performance without visible warning signs — unless you're monitoring the right signals and acting on them. Our optimisation loop runs on a structured cycle: review, diagnose, adjust, measure. Creative is rotated based on frequency thresholds. Targeting is refined based on engagement signals. Budget is reallocated toward the highest-performing campaigns. Every adjustment is documented and reported.

Structured optimisation cycle (weekly review, bi-weekly adjustment)

Creative rotation schedule based on frequency and performance data

Targeting refinement based on engagement and conversion signals

Budget reallocation across campaigns based on performance
